What an Intake Manifold Does in a Chevy Engine
The intake manifold distributes air, and in many Chevrolet engines it also carries coolant and supports multiple vacuum passages.
On GM small-block and LS-based engines, the manifold must seal tightly to the cylinder heads so the engine can maintain proper air-fuel mixture, coolant flow, and idle quality.
When the manifold gasket, intake manifold itself, or related seals fail, outside air, coolant, or engine oil can move where it should not.
That disruption affects combustion, idle speed, emissions, and temperature control.
Most Common Chevy Engine Intake Manifold Leak Symptoms
The exact signs depend on whether the leak is an air leak, coolant leak, or a combination of both.
In many cases, more than one symptom appears at the same time.
Rough Idle or Surging at Stoplights
A vacuum leak from a damaged intake gasket often causes rough idle because unmetered air enters the engine.
You may notice the RPMs dip, fluctuate, or recover slowly when the engine is warm.
This is especially common on V8 Chevy trucks and SUVs with aging gaskets.
Check Engine Light with Lean Codes
One of the clearest chevy engine intake manifold leak symptoms is a Check Engine Light accompanied by lean fuel trim codes such as P0171 or P0174.
These codes mean the engine control module is seeing too much air or not enough fuel in the mixture, often from a vacuum leak around the intake manifold.
Hissing or Whistling Sounds
A small leak may produce a noticeable hissing, sucking, or whistling noise near the intake area.
The sound is usually most obvious at idle or during light throttle.
On some Chevrolet engines, the noise is louder when plastic intake components crack or when a gasket shifts out of place.
Coolant Loss Without an Obvious External Leak
Many Chevy intake manifolds route coolant through the manifold or gasket passages.
If the seal fails, coolant can seep into the intake ports, into the valley area, or externally down the engine block.
Drivers may keep topping off the radiator or reservoir without finding a drip under the vehicle.
White Smoke or Sweet Smell from the Exhaust
If coolant enters the combustion chamber through a failed intake manifold gasket, the exhaust may produce white smoke and a sweet antifreeze odor.
This is more concerning than a simple vacuum leak because it can indicate coolant contamination inside the engine.
Misfires and Hard Starting
Air entering through an intake leak can create a lean condition that causes misfires, especially at idle and low RPM.
You may feel a stumble on acceleration, a shaky idle, or longer cranking after the vehicle sits.
In severe cases, the engine may stall when coming to a stop.
Oil Contamination or Milky Residue
On certain engines, a serious coolant leak may lead to milky oil on the dipstick or under the oil cap.
While intake leaks do not always contaminate engine oil, the presence of moisture or sludge should be treated as a serious warning sign.
It can point to broader sealing issues that need immediate inspection.
Which Chevy Engines Are More Prone to Intake Manifold Problems?
Any Chevrolet engine can develop intake sealing issues over time, but some platforms are better known for them.
Older small-block V8s, certain GM 4.3L V6 engines, and some LS-family engines can experience gasket deterioration, plastic manifold cracking, or bolt-related sealing issues as mileage climbs.
Heat cycling is a major factor.
Repeated expansion and contraction can harden rubber seals, shrink gasket material, and distort plastic or composite manifolds.
Engines that have experienced overheating are also more likely to develop intake sealing failures later.
How to Tell an Intake Manifold Leak from Other Problems
Because several engine issues share similar symptoms, it helps to separate the likely causes before replacing parts.
- Vacuum leak: rough idle, lean codes, hissing sound, high or unstable idle.
- Coolant leak at the intake: unexplained coolant loss, white smoke, sweet smell, possible overheating.
- Head gasket failure: coolant loss plus compression issues, overheating, bubbles in the radiator, or cross-contamination in oil.
- Throttle body or PCV issue: idle problems and air leaks, but often with different sound patterns and fewer coolant symptoms.
A professional technician may use a smoke machine, cooling system pressure test, scan tool fuel trim data, or UV dye to confirm the source.
If fuel trims are positive at idle and improve with higher RPM, that often points toward a vacuum leak near the intake manifold.

Why Intake Manifold Leaks Should Not Be Ignored
A vacuum leak can cause the engine to run lean, which increases combustion temperatures and can stress oxygen sensors, spark plugs, and catalytic converters.
A coolant leak can be even more serious because it can lead to overheating, hydro-lock in extreme cases, and internal engine damage.
Ignoring the symptoms can also create misleading secondary failures.
For example, a driver may replace ignition parts, mass airflow sensors, or fuel injectors when the real problem is an intake manifold gasket leak that is upsetting the air-fuel ratio.
What a Repair Usually Involves
Repairing an intake manifold leak usually requires removing the manifold, cleaning the mating surfaces, and installing new gaskets and seals.
On some Chevy engines, technicians also replace thermostat housing seals, coolant elbows, or intake bolts if the design calls for it.
Proper torque sequence and torque specification matter.
An over-tightened intake can warp the manifold or crush the gasket unevenly, while under-tightening can leave a persistent leak.
If the manifold is cracked or the sealing surface is damaged, replacement may be necessary instead of a gasket-only repair.
Preventive Maintenance Tips for Chevy Owners
- Keep the cooling system in good condition to reduce heat stress on gaskets.
- Replace coolant on schedule so old fluid does not accelerate seal deterioration.
- Watch for early signs of overheating, since heat cycles are hard on intake seals.
- Inspect hoses, PCV components, and vacuum lines during routine service.
- Address misfires and lean codes early instead of driving for weeks with unresolved symptoms.
